If there isn't room in the plan for a pantry, an 84" tall cabinet pantry with roll-out drawers is a great alternative. Alternatively, open cabinets may employ stand-alone shelves that are mounted onto the walls of your kitchen where upper cabinetry usually exists. Open kitchen cabinets also cut down on the cost of your kitchen cabinets; without cabinet doors, less material is required to create your cabinets.
